For the suppressor, I would recommend the Q Thunder Chicken. It is super quiet and light. I've shot it next to my brothers .308 w/ a Sig can and it has my .300wm almost as quiet as his .308 shooting factory ammo. POI shift is also minimal. That will run you at least $1150.
For the rifle, based off of your budget, I would take a look at the Browning X-bolt Hell's Canyon line. I have one in 300wm. It was a little finicky with ammo at first, but I have a reload that is holding it right at an MOA. I believe it is available in both of the calibers that you are looking at. I would take the 7mag over the .270

$1000 for a suppressor...I would recommend a Omega.
$1000 for a decent scope.
Leaves you $1000 to $1500 for a rifle....
If your going with 7mm mag or 280ai which are wonderful calibers your going to need a 24” barrel to get the most out of that caliber....add a 6” to 8” can on there and it’s going to be crazy long to try to hunt with. Personally I would forget the suppressor and put that money towards the rifle. Or build a 7-08 or 308 at 20” which is all the barrel you need for those calibers and then use your suppressor.
